Visit the ancient ruins of the spectacular uninhabited island of Delos and then the cosmopolitan Mykonos at lunchtime.
Sail the Archipelagos from Naxos, explore the most sacred of all the Greek islands, Delos.
Have 3 hours of free time to wander around the impressive ruins, imagine ancient Greeks wandering around and admire the excavated artifacts in the small local museum.
Hiring a private professional licensed guide once you enter the archaeological site will upgrade your experience.
You can also join one of the groups formed on the spot to spare some cash by sharing the same guide.
Afterwards, cruise to the posh island of Mykonos with 3 full hours of free time. Some even rent a motorbike for a few hours to explore Mykonos.
Walk in the narrow streets of the town with the premium brand shops at Matoyanni Str. and stroll in the pretty alleys all the way to the romantic "Little Venice" to enjoy a coffee or a cocktail with the sea washing your feet.
Climb the hill to see the famous windmills up close and get spectacular views of the surroundings.
Swim at the beach near the port or have lunch at one of the traditional Greek tavernas within walking distance from the port. Sail back to Naxos in the early evening.
